Role Summary
As the CMM Programmer (ZEISS), you will be responsible for programming, operating and maintaining the coordinate measuring machines to perform dimensional inspection of parts, ensuring accuracy, repeatability and compliance with drawings and specifications. Your work will support first article inspection (FAI), in-process checks and final release inspections.
Key Responsibilities
Develop and maintain CMM programs using the ZEISS Calypso (or equivalent) software for ZEISS CMM machines.
Set up the CMM (fix fixturing, choose probes, define measurement routines) and execute measurement cycles.
Interpret engineering drawings and GD&T symbols accurately; translate into measurement strategies.
Perform first-article inspections, in-process and final dimensional inspections; generate reports of findings.
Analyse measurement data, identify trends / deviations, propose corrections or improvements.
Collaborate with production, engineering and quality teams to resolve quality issues and ensure tooling, fixtures and processes are measurement-friendly.
Maintain and calibrate metrology equipment, ensure measurement environment is compliant.
Support audits and quality system requirements (ISO 9001 / IATF 16949 / AS9100 as relevant).
